For over 19 years, The Lake Clinic has served floating villages on Cambodia's Tonle Sap Lake-communities that live entirely on water, with no land, no roads, and no access to land-based health services. Our boats and floating clinics are their only link to medical care. But a clinic is its people. This project sustains our 25+ Cambodian staff: doctors, nurses, midwives, outreach workers, pilots, and cooks. Your support funds their salaries, their families, and their commitment to community.
Your donation directly funds staff salaries and essential operations-the "invisible costs" that keep us afloat. We prioritize: 1) Staff salaries, 2) Medical supplies, 3) Boat fuel and maintenance. This ensures our team of 25+ Cambodian staff can continue reaching isolated floating villages with medical care, vaccinations, prenatal support, and health education.
